What Is Corona Virus?

Corona is a large group of viruses which can infect both humans and animals with cold-related diseases. The intensity of the infection ranges from common colds to acute respiratory syndrome.

However, the new strain of Coronavirus, called 2019-nCoV, is a novel virus to humans. So the information related to the disease, including symptoms and means of treatment is limited.

The CDC, in cooperation with WHO and international experts, are working to combat the virus.

What are the Symptoms of the Coronavirus?

  1. Coughing
  2. Fever
  3. Shortness of breath
  4. Pneumonia
  5. Vomiting
  6. Diarrhoea

In advanced cases, the patient can have serious complications that can result in death, such as:

  • Severe Pneumonia
  • Kidney Failure

How is the Coronavirus Transmitted?

  1. Direct contact with an infected patient.
  2. Droplets from patient’s coughing and sneezing
  3. Contact with patient’s belongings followed by touching your nose or mouth

Precautions:

  1. Keep your hands clean at all times. Regularly and thoroughly wash your hands with soap and water, and use alcohol-based hand sanitizer WHY? Washing your hands with soap and water or using alcohol-based hand rub kills viruses that may be on your hands.
  1. Maintain at least 1 metre (3 feet) distance between you and anyone who is coughing or sneezing. WHY: When someone coughs or sneezes they spray small liquid droplets from their nose or mouth may contain the virus. If you are too close, you can breathe in the droplets, including COVID-19 virus (Coronavirus) if the person coughing has the disease.
  1. Avoid touching eyes, nose and mouth WHY? Hands touch many surfaces and can pick up viruses. Once contaminated, hands can transfer the virus to your eyes, nose or mouth. From there, the virus can enter the body and make you sick.
  1. People coughing persistently or sneezing should stay indoors or keep a social distance, but not mix with a crowd. WHY: Will decrease chances of spread and keep everyone safe.
  1. Ensure that you and people around you follow good respiratory hygiene by covering mouths and noses with a handkerchief or tissue while sneezing or coughing. You can also sneeze or cough into your sleeve at the bent elbow. Then dispose of the used tissue immediately. WHY: Droplets spread virus. By following good respiratory hygiene, you protect the people around you from viruses such as cold, flu and COVID-19.
